Template:Character Infobox Captain Douglas Gordon is the American captain of the Gotengo. He is portrayed by MMA fighter, Don Frye. His only appearance was in the 2004 Godzilla film, Godzilla: Final Wars. Template:TOC

Godzilla: Final Wars
Many years before the events of Final Wars, Gordon was part of the crew of the first Gotengo when the vessel battled Godzilla in Antarctica. In fact, he was the one that fired the winning shot that buried Godzilla in an avalanche. He is also part of the Earth Defense Force.
In Godzilla: Final Wars, he was the captain of the Gotengo. He and his crew fought off Manda in the beginning of the movie. Among the members of the crew, were Shinichi Ozaki, and Katsunori Kazama. Gordon was definitely an important contributor to the annihilation of the Xiliens, also. The plan to save Earth was developed by him, and he lead his Gotengo team to Area G, where they purposely woke up Godzilla, hoping he would be able to help them defeat the Xiliens, thus saving Earth.
